Day 1 - Kruger National Park - Mpumalanga Province
Departure early in the morning from Pretoria/Johannesburg and as we travel in a
eastern direction towards the Mpumalanga Province, we visit many attractions and view points along the Panorama
Route, including the Bourke's Luck Potholes, the Three Rondavels, Gods Window and the historic gold mining town of Pilgrims Rest. We descend in the late afternoon the eastern escarpment and travel through the low veld to our country lodge, outside the Kruger National Park.
Accommodation: Country Lodge
Dinner, bed & breakfast basis.
Distance traveled: 430 km

Day 3 - Limpopo/Mpumalanga Province - Private Game Reserve
We exit the Kruger Park after breakfast and travel to our exclusive lodge in a Private Game Reserve. Later during the day, we will undertake a exhilarating sunset safari in specially adapted open 4 X 4 vehicles.. At sunset, sundowners are enjoyed deep in the bush, and after sunset, the ranger will making use of spotlights to search for nocturnal animals. A specially prepared dinner is awaiting us under the stars around the campfire at the lodge. (weather permitting)
Accommodation: Private Game Lodge
All meals inclusive & sunset/sunrise safaris in open game vehicles.
Distance traveled: 105 km
Day 4 - Limpopo/Mpumalanga Province - Private Game Reserve
An early wake up call signals the start of yet another exciting day in Big Five territory.
You depart on an early morning safari in open 4 x 4 vehicles after which you return to the lodge for a late breakfast.
After breakfast you can embark on a guided bush walk with an armed ranger, who will identify spoor and droppings and share with you some of the fascinating secrets of the bush. If you are lucky you may come across big game on foot - a truly exhilarating experience.
This evening another safari in open 4 x 4 vehicles is undertaken, followed by a scrumptious South African dinner
Accommodation: Private Game Lodge
Fully inclusive of all meals & game-viewing activities.

Day 7 - Sunday - Western Cape Province - Cape Town
Today you undertake a full day Cape Point Tour, following Africa's premier tour route to the romantic meeting place of the Indian and Atlantic Oceans. Sir Francis Drake the explorer called it "the fairest cape that we saw in the circumference of the globe" This tour offers a full and exciting day out.
Includes:
- Clifton & Camps Bay beach views
- Houtbay, Optional trip to seal island
- Chapman's Peak Drive
- Cape Point & Nature Reserve
- Cape of Good Hope
- Optional stop for lunch at Fish Hoek Galley
- Kirstenbosch botanical gardens

Pretoriuskop
The impressive granite dome known as "Shabeni hill" is not far from the Pretoriuskop Rest Camp, which is found in the south-western corner of
the world-renowned Kruger National Park. It is immediately apparent to any visitor that Pretoriuskop, Kruger oldest rest camp, is unlike any other rest camp in the Kruger National Park.
Brilliant red trees adorn Kruger like surroundings, pre-dating the decision to make exclusive use of
indigenous plants in laying out rest camp gardens.
